The Original British Motorcycling Company.

At Triumph, we are driven to make the best motorcycles in the world. Building iconic motorcycles that celebrate our past whilst embracing the future – through bold design, original styling, purposeful engineering and a genuine passion for the ride.

We are looking for engineering analysts to join our expanding simulation team, using tools such as FEA (finite element analysis), CFD (computational fluid dynamics) and MBD (multi-body dynamics) in a pragmatic way to drive our designs forward. Whilst embedded in a dedicated simulation team, successful applicants will work alongside the whole design department on Adventure, Roadster, Classic and Racing motorcycles, analysing components and systems throughout the entire vehicle.
You will use simulation technologies to enhance and optimise designs during the design phase of projects and use the same tools to respond quickly to problems during prototype testing bringing understanding and potential solutions. Applicants will need excellent analytical, problem-solving and team-working skills.
